[deepamehta-users] DeepaMehta 4.0.1 released

Jörg Richter jri at deepamehta.de
Do Jul 28 20:20:00 CEST 2011


Hi,

on July 28, 2011 DeepaMehta 4.0.1 has been released.

This release fixes a bug: when editing an association (e.g. retyping) the role types are not compromised.

Thanks Malte for reporting!

You can update a 4.0 installation while keeping your content, however a 4.0.1 clean install is recommended (see note below).
See the README for update instructions (scroll down).
https://github.com/jri/deepamehta

Download the release:
https://github.com/downloads/jri/deepamehta/deepamehta-4.0.1.zip

Build from Source:
https://trac.deepamehta.de/wiki/BuildFromSource

For reporting issues please register at our new trac-site:
https://trac.deepamehta.de

Cheers,
Jörg


--------------------

Technical note 1:

In DeepaMehta 4.0.1 the data model has slightly changed: Topic types are never used as role types anymore. Instead the new role type "Default" is used. The existing 4.0 type definitions in the DB are not migrated. However, the 4.0.1 application code is compatible with the 4.0 model.

Affected are the following association semantics:
    - Core: data type assignment of a topic/association type
    - Core: index mode assignment of a topic/association type
    - Topicmaps: topic/association assignments of a topicmap
    - Workspaces: topic/type assignments of a workspace

CAUTION when editing such an association that was created with 4.0:
In this situation you must set role type "Default" manually for the correct association end.
Otherwise the respective association gets corrupted.

For associations newly created in 4.0.1 there is no issue.


Technical note 2:

These 3rd party components are updated in 4.0.1:
- Jersey 1.5 -> 1.8
- Jettison 1.2 -> 1.3
- Neo4j Mehtagraph 0.7 -> 0.8





Mehr Informationen über die Mailingliste users